The warrior kit comes with vent tubes also. Is there any reason to extend those up with snorkels or ok to leave in stock location?
@roguelegend11754 жыл бұрын
Most definitely wanna use those vents. There should be one for the front diff one for the trans and one for the rear diff. You will fill those parts up with water if you don’t use them and plan on going deep.

Hey man you gotta tell me how you did that I really wanna snorkel my 2007 artic cat 500 carb manual
@roguelegend11754 жыл бұрын
On this bike. Make sure both of your carb boots and air box tubes are all sealed. Use grease on the carb boots. Make sure the vent lines that are on top of the carb are run up. Make sure you have a drain tube and a 1 way check valve hanging down for your over flow vent that’s on the bottom of the carb bowl. If it has electric choke try and get rid of it. Pull the choke out of the carb take it apart put the needle back in with a spring and a good plug that’s sealed. Adjust the float level for a little more fuel in the carb for the front end floating for more than a few min at a time. Make sure your gas gap is sealed. Grease your spark plug boots. I siliconed the spark splug wire connection at the coil. Pull your Ecu and check the back side of it. They have factory silicone backs on the them and they dry out and crack and will allow water in (sometimes) and then get rid of your pull cord or silicone the handle on.

Hey man, I know you posted this a year ago but I have the same bike and was wondering what all you did to make it water worthy? I’m trying to make sure I grease everything and don’t forgot any vent lines.
@roguelegend11754 жыл бұрын
It’s cool. On this bike. I greased all the electrical plugs with di electric grease. Including spark plug boots and where the spark plug wires attach to the coil. I actually siliconed the connections at the coil. Pull your ecu and inspect the bottom side. Should be a silicon backside. Make sure it’s not dried out and letting water in. Get rid of the pull cord and seal it. If you have electric choke on the carb. Get rid of it, but you have to leave the needle inside with a spring and a good plug. I had a buddy machine an aluminum cap to press into the hole. Make sure your float level is set for the front end floating for more than a few min. Make sure your overflow vent on the bottom of the carb is hanging down with a one way check valve. Make sure all the other vents are run up. And other than sealed snorkels to the belt box and air box. That should be about it.

How did u make the carb water tight?
@roguelegend11754 жыл бұрын
It took a few times trying to seal it but if your dealing with a mid 2000s arctic cat 500. Then just make sure you’re starting with a good carb. Make sure the boots are good that connect it to the engine and air box. Run the vent line off the top of the carb up high. The lower vent line(over flow) tube will need a good quality one way check valve hanging beneath the carb. If you have a electric choke do away with it. You’ll need to pull it out and cut it loose and put the needle back in along with a spring and plug. Use silicone or di electric grease around the cap where the throttle cable is connected to the butterfly. Make sure your float level is adjusted for water wheelies also.

If we can get one we're gonna try to go. you gotta make sure that 850 is sealed up good before you go to deep. Even with factory snorkels you should go ahead and make sure all the connections are super sturdy and sealed. grease your spark plug boots and your ecu plugs and any other electrical connections you can get to. i also use di electric grease around my airbox lids on all my machines. We watched a kid at boggs a few weeks ago sit the whole weekend out cause his got a little water either in the spark plug boots or coil or ecu it was skippin and poppin. he kept saying it wasnt even broke in yet like 6 or 7 hours on it. same bike you got.
